Postdoctoral Fellow to join the research project PATH (Pathways for SMEs to protect and restore Ecosystems).
Universite du Québec à Trois‑Rivières (UQTR)
Canada
Deadline: Aug 31, 2026

Your profile
This position is designed for a curious and engaged researcher who is committed to
transdisciplinary and socially relevant research and who fulfills the following requirements
• Completed a Ph.D. between 2023 and 2026;
• Experience conducting qualitative and/or mixed-methods research.
• Strong analytical skills, including proficiency in quantitative and qualitative analysis
software (e.g., R, NVivo).
• Excellent facilitation skills for working with diverse stakeholder groups.
• Excellent organizational skills and strong ability to work independently and collaboratively
within an interdisciplinary team.
• Strong experience with transdisciplinary sustainability research.
• Excellent communication in French and English.
How to apply
Interested candidates are invited to submit the following documents by August 31, 2026
• A 1‑page cover letter outlining personal motivations, qualifications and your
experiences relevant to the position;
• A curriculum vitae, including a list of publications;
• Three writing samples (e.g., published articles, dissertation chapters, or manuscripts);
• The names and contact information of three referees who may be contacted for letters
of reference.
The application should be addressed to Christopher Luederitz and Karina Benessaiah and
submitted to the following email address: christopher.luederitz@uqtr.ca
Results
Applications will be reviewed on a rolling basis until August 31. The anticipated start date is
October 1, 2026, or earlier. Candidates who are not selected will be notified by the end of
September
